Twisted The Root of All Evil
The Bible is full of wisdom. People love to quote their favorite verses to encourage and inspire each other—but sometimes, those verses get taken out of context. What happens when the most important message of all gets Twisted?

In this four-week message series starting this Sunday, we will cover four of the most misused verses in the Bible. Learn the context of the verses, what they really mean, and how to find the richness God actually meant to show us through them. Verses in this series include “for I know the plans I have for you…” in Jeremiah 29:11, “ask anything in my name” in John 14:14, and others.

Series: Twisted
Message: “The Root of All Evil”
Text: 1 Timothy 6:10
Sunday, January 29, 2017
Pastor Tom Cogle

For the love of money is a root of all kinds of evil.
1 Timothy 6:10

HOW DO YOU TRANSLATE THE BIBLE?
1.Understand the context.
2.Interpret scriptures with other scriptures.
3.Apply what you learn.

How much money do you need to be happy?
Just a little bit more!

The richest are not those who have the most, but those who need the least.

Discontentment can make a rich person poor, and contentment can make a poor person rich.

We are wealthy compared to most of the world.

Money promises what only God can provide.

When we really think we need more money to be happy, satisfied or secure, we are deceived and under the power of and influence of money.

When you don’t have a lot of Jesus, money looks really good. When you have more of Jesus, then you can be content with what you have, because godliness with contentment is great gain.
